So, here's the weird thing...Systeme actually makes it SUPER easy to share templates with other people...but there's no obvious way to directly turn an email you create into a separate template.
What do I mean? Well, something that shows up down at the bottom when you go to create a campaign step:

So, what I wound up doing was just duplicating the first step and editing it to be my second step, and so on. I also duplicated the campaign when it still had only one step in it, and cleared out the contents of that first step, and named it as a template.
There's a tiny catch, though; you can only have one email campaign in each account or subaccount, if you're on the free plan. So after I created this "template" campaign, I was unable to add any more campaigns, and of course it wouldn't have allowed me to activate both of them at the same time.
Systeme also sent me an email in the wee hours of the following morning to let me know that my account would be restricted in 3 days' time if I did not remove the resources that exceeded the limits of my plan. ๐ Nice of them to give me a warning though, so I went ahead and deleted the extra.
That's fine for now, as I only need one freebie lead magnet campaign at the moment, and when I'm ready to start expanding, it'll only be $17/month or less (depending on whether I pay monthly or annually) to upgrade to the next tier, which has up to 10 campaigns. Super reasonable!
